Address

D5rFUVARPr7YnVea1Vr5rd7ZNx7Wfx93Z5

0 DGB

Confirmed
Total Received2879558 DGB24307.36 USD
Total Sent2879558 DGB24307.36 USD
Final Balance0 DGB0.00 USD
No. Transactions2

Transactions

D5rFUVARPr7YnVea1Vr5rd7ZNx7Wfx93Z52879558 DGB458.17 USD24307.36 USD
 
DAK3MLkna8MjCBz6Wc67R1WAD5o2UjjNx52879533 DGB458.16 USD24307.15 USD
SWJwdR52fSp2Dy14LFN3rowVDVCy25E4bQ24 DGB0.00 USD0.20 USD×
DFQE3myyVUSo9Aw8kLg3eQ1x1nEgroQvJ22879567 DGB458.17 USD24307.43 USD
 
ScnH258bhCeh17cNQ2qywQEDSxDtZgPL7z8 DGB0.00 USD0.07 USD×
D5rFUVARPr7YnVea1Vr5rd7ZNx7Wfx93Z52879558 DGB458.17 USD24307.36 USD